REPAIR BLDG NO. 1020, FOS is a federal award for 646th Support Detachment held by Elrim Construction Co.., Ltd. Estimated value $7.1M ($915K obligated). Current period of performance ends Jun 30, 2024. Last award drew 11 bidders. Related solicitation W91QVN18R0006.

Current PoP ended Jun 30, 2024 (782 days ago). The usual 12–18 month agency planning window is closed — recompete action looks late / overdue relative to a normal cycle. Watch for bridge orders, follow-ons, or a new solicitation.
